WebApr 5, 2024 · Hang up your flag, and spritz the fabric with water. Allow the flag to dry. For deep-set wrinkles, wash your flag as instructed, then dry it flat. A few hours of hanging … WebApr 12, 2024 · Fill the steamer with water and turn it on to heat up. Hang your nylon flag or fabric on a hanger or clothesline. Hold the steamer about 6 inches away from the fabric and move it in a gentle back-and-forth motion. Use your hand to smooth out the fabric as you steam it. Continue steaming until all the wrinkles are gone.

WebJun 28, 2024 · How to Make Scented Water. Making scented ironing water is easy. First, add 1 teaspoon of your chosen essential oil to 1 tablespoon of either witch hazel or vodka and then shake well to mix. Pour 16 ounces of distilled water into the spray bottle you plan to use and then add the fragrance mixture to the distilled water and shake again.
